Job description

VIQU are partnering with a leading organisation to recruit a Full Stack Developer to play a key role in the development, maintenance, and enhancement of the organisation's web-based applications and supporting infrastructure. This is an excellent opportunity for a technically strong developer with experience in high-availability environments who is keen to support new initiatives, including the implementation of CI/CD pipelines via Azure DevOps., * Design, develop, and maintain scalable web-based applications using C#, .NET, and JavaScript frameworks.

  • Support and enhance the organisation's high-availability environment, ensuring performance and reliability.
  • Work with NetScaler for load balancing, SSL offloading, and application-level routing logic.
  • Manage and maintain the organisation's source control systems and version management.
  • Collaborate with internal teams to design, test, and deploy new software features.
  • Contribute to the planning and rollout of CI/CD pipelines using Azure DevOps.
  • Troubleshoot technical issues, ensuring smooth operation of critical business systems.
  • Document development processes and maintain clear, reusable code standards.

Requirements

  • Proven experience in full stack development using C#, .NET, and modern JavaScript frameworks.
  • Strong understanding of web application architecture and high-availability environments.
  • Hands-on experience with load balancing and request routing technologies, ideally NetScaler or similar.
  • Proficiency in managing and deploying web applications across multiple servers.
  • Good knowledge of SQL Server and database performance optimisation.
  • Familiarity with Azure DevOps, Git, or equivalent source control systems.
  • Understanding of CI/CD concepts and experience implementing automated deployments.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ills with a collaborative approach to development.
